Davao — The Philippine Charity Sweepstakes Office (PCSO) has officially activated its emergency response mechanism to deliver immediate humanitarian assistance to communities severely affected by recent flash floods in Davao City. Acting swiftly on presidential directives, the agency mobilized its regional branches and forged strategic partnerships with private sector entities less than 24 hours after swollen waterways inundated local neighborhoods. This rapid intervention highlights the government's unwavering commitment to providing prompt, equitable, and compassionate support to calamity-stricken citizens across the country without delay.

Activating Quick Response Mechanisms and Private Partnerships

Following severe weather driven by the southwest monsoon that caused rivers to overflow on July 24, PCSO General Manager Melquiades A. Robles ordered regional offices to immediately coordinate ground relief. Recognizing that speed is critical during natural calamities, the agency tapped its robust network of Authorized Agent Corporations to significantly augment government resources. Key private partners—including Hexaprime Inc., Magic Three Gaming Corp., Northman Gaming Corp., and Antiguas Gaming Corporation—stepped forward as part of the first wave of donors to distribute essential provisions to displaced residents.
